Wastegate/RRFPR Source
In my current configuration, my wastegate gets its signal from the compressor housing. My MSD 1:1 rising rate fuel pressure regulator gets its signal from the intake plenum. I'm running at 7psi without any problems right now.
I was just reading in Maximum Boost that these two should be coming from the same source, so in my case I would switch the MSD fpr to a t'd line off of the compressor housing. My factory fpr is still in place to regulate under vacuum. Does this make sense to you? I know Maximum Boost isn't perfect, and this specific section was referring to carbed setups, but I thought it was worth the question. |
